存放任何数据
package string_test
import (
"testing"
)
func TestString(t *testing.T) {
var s string
t.Log(s) // 初始化为默认零值""
s = "hello"
t.Log(len(s)) // 输出:5
//s[1] = '3' // string 是不可变的 byte slice,报错:cannot assign to s[1]
s = "\xE4\xB8\xA5" // 可以存储任何二进制数据
t.Log(s) // 输出:严
t.Log(len(s)) // 输出:3
}
rune 是一种新的数据类型,能够取出字符串里面的一种 unicode